Joining Walmart and other retailers looking to get a head start on next week’s Black Friday festivities, Best Buy today began offering limited-time deals on a number of products. Among those products is a first generation iPad Air, and fifth-gen iPod touch, both of which have been significantly discounted.

For the next three days, Best Buy is taking between $80 and $100 off all iPad Air models—the discount depends on the model you buy. While the original Air is more than a year old now, it still features a newer hardware design and packs plenty of power. The 16GB Wi-Fi-only model is a steal at just $319.

As for the iPod touch, Best Buy has shaved $50 off the price of the 64GB 5th gen model, meaning you can get it for just $249. That’s more than you’ll pay for an entry-level iPad this holiday season, but if you or the person you’re buying the gift for has a large music collection, you’ll need the bigger hard drive.

Rounding out the deals are Beats Solo HD On-Ear headphones, which have been discounted $70 and now cost just $99, and a couple of wireless speakers. iHome’s AirPlay speaker system is just $49.99 right now, normally $299.99, and the water-resistant Ultimate Ears Boom speaker is $20 off at $179.99.

Best Buy says these deals are good through Saturday, when it will presumably place another group of items on sale.
